Bamboo charcoal coated with silver (BC/Ag) was prepared by activation and chemical reduction processes
at different AgNO3 contents (10-30 wt.%). The spectroscopic characterizations of the formation
processes of BC/Ag composites were studied using X-ray diffraction, scanning electron microscopy and
transmission electron microscopy. These composites were introduced in epoxy resin to be a microwave
absorber and mixed polyethylene to be an infrared stealth plate.Microwave absorbing properties were investigated
by measuring complex permittivity, complex permeability and reflection loss in the 2-18 and
18-40 GHz microwave frequency range using the free space method. The thermal extinction measurements
in the 3-5 and 8-12 m were done to evaluate the shielding affectivity of infrared. The results
showed that a significant thermal extinction and a wider absorption frequency range could be obtained by
adding silver to bamboo charcoal. - 英文摘要: --
